Output 177314173e5488ffe391dd593a62a21d869c10d988b19ef179c7ee58751c2f95:0

value
33386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7511010e80176e0660e7f5de1b0d41c5f787e3d8 OP_EQUAL
address
3CN1MTNEaEyW3S3MKSK6RMGrPcjkFoirST
transaction
177314173e5488ffe391dd593a62a21d869c10d988b19ef179c7ee58751c2f95
spent
true